Wood Cladding Replacement in Boston, MA
Wood cladding replacement services involve removing damaged or outdated wood exterior panels and installing new cladding to enhance the appearance and durability of a property’s exterior. This service covers a variety of projects, including updating worn or rotting wood siding, replacing sections affected by weather damage, or upgrading to more modern or aesthetically pleasing wood styles. Property owners often seek this service to improve curb appeal, protect the building from moisture intrusion, or address structural concerns related to compromised wood panels.

Wood Cladding Replacement Questions
What is wood cladding replacement? It involves removing damaged or outdated wood siding and installing new panels to improve appearance and durability.
When should wood cladding be replaced? Replacement is recommended when existing wood shows signs of rot, extensive damage, or significant weathering.
What types of wood are used for cladding replacement? Common options include cedar, redwood, and pressure-treated pine, chosen for their durability and appearance.
What should property owners consider before replacing wood cladding? It's important to assess the condition of the existing siding and choose materials that match the property's style and climate needs.
